Roll CanvasKit to 0.38.0

Change-Id: Ibf5051a86adf22e1abd3dcd03b60be07707a1d97
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/629316
Reviewed-by: Leandro Lovisolo <lovisolo@google.com>
diff --git a/modules/canvaskit/CHANGELOG.md b/modules/canvaskit/CHANGELOG.md
index 4a1772f..0b2bce8 100644
--- a/modules/canvaskit/CHANGELOG.md
+++ b/modules/canvaskit/CHANGELOG.md
@@ -6,6 +6,8 @@
 
 ## [Unreleased]
 
+## [0.38.0] - 2023-01-12
+
 ### Changed
  - `Paragraph.getRectsForRange` and `Paragraph.getRectsForPlaceholders` had been returning a list
    of Float32Arrays upon which a property 'direction' had been monkey-patched (this was
diff --git a/modules/canvaskit/Makefile b/modules/canvaskit/Makefile
index e2958c0..f070fab 100644
--- a/modules/canvaskit/Makefile
+++ b/modules/canvaskit/Makefile
@@ -87,7 +87,7 @@
 
 	# These features are turned off to keep code size smaller for the
 	# general use case.
-	./compile.sh release no_skottie no_particles no_rt_shader no_sksl_trace no_alias_font \
+	./compile.sh release no_skottie no_particles no_sksl_trace no_alias_font \
 		no_effects_deserialization no_encode_jpeg no_encode_webp legacy_draw_vertices \
 		no_embedded_font
 	cp ../../out/canvaskit_wasm/canvaskit.js       ./npm_build/bin
diff --git a/modules/canvaskit/npm_build/package-lock.json b/modules/canvaskit/npm_build/package-lock.json
index e3b0425f..c3e214f 100644
--- a/modules/canvaskit/npm_build/package-lock.json
+++ b/modules/canvaskit/npm_build/package-lock.json
@@ -1,12 +1,12 @@
 {
   "name": "canvaskit-wasm",
-  "version": "0.37.2",
+  "version": "0.38.0",
   "lockfileVersion": 2,
   "requires": true,
   "packages": {
     "": {
       "name": "canvaskit-wasm",
-      "version": "0.37.2",
+      "version": "0.38.0",
       "license": "BSD-3-Clause",
       "devDependencies": {
         "@definitelytyped/header-parser": "0.0.121",
diff --git a/modules/canvaskit/npm_build/package.json b/modules/canvaskit/npm_build/package.json
index 916b557..19226f1 100644
--- a/modules/canvaskit/npm_build/package.json
+++ b/modules/canvaskit/npm_build/package.json
@@ -1,6 +1,6 @@
 {
   "name": "canvaskit-wasm",
-  "version": "0.37.2",
+  "version": "0.38.0",
   "description": "A WASM version of Skia's Canvas API",
   "main": "bin/canvaskit.js",
   "homepage": "https://github.com/google/skia/tree/main/modules/canvaskit",